THE ONE AND ONLY

Tough, simplistic and marketed directly to America's youth, Ford's U13 Bronco Roadster was, in many ways, a tall factory dune buggy. Because these utes were used more as tools than cruisers, they saw fairly limited production; and the units that did roll off the assembly line often led brutal lives with predictably low survival rates. That's precisely where future collectability comes in, and when it comes to collectability, it simply doesn't get much better than this Springtime Yellow stomper!

One of just 698 U13s produced for the 1967 model year, this truck was also one of only 333 units marked for export, and one of just 70 units exported to South America. But wait, there's more. In addition to being fitted with a unique hardtop and exclusive Barn Doors during its time in Colombia, it is presently the ONLY fully restored U13 Roadster export that's made its way back to America. That means it's also the ONLY fully restored American U13 that's equipped with Barn Doors.

After almost four decades in Colombia, this fine Ford was brought back to its homeland and subjected to a frame-off, nut-and-bolt restoration that was completed over the course of one year. That said, one year is probably a bit of an understatement since the project actually started eight years ago when the restorer inked papers to ship the truck north. CORRECT AND ONLY

As most Ford historians probably know, Dearborn kicked off Bronco production with a 170 cubic inch inline 6-cylinder. That means the completely rebuilt and carefully detailed mill you see in this ute's super clean engine bay is factory-correct. Designed from the ground up to be a tough-as-nails workhorse and, serving as primary Bronco power for almost a decade, the Thriftpower Six is a favorite among vintage truck fans because of its simple design, adequate power and excellent durability. And, in the name of authenticity, pretty much everything on this ute's 170 has been returned to intentional, factory-spec simplicity; with details like a correct FoMoCo washer bag and fresh Radio Resistance plug wires complementing items like a familiar Sta-Ful battery topper and pliable FoMoCo hoses.

ONLY AS IT WERE

Recruited directly from the factory to be a purposeful runabout, this Roadster's been Built Ford Tough literally from day one! Power meets the pavement through a correct row-it-yourself 3-speed, which was the only kit Ford offered during the Bronco's early years. A correct 9-inch rear axle spins correct 4.57 gears that, fitted during the truck's assembly, were a direct response to Colombia's low compression fuel. A requisite Dana 30 front axle leads to a 2.5-inch suspension lift. Stops are provided by a quartet of manual drums. An aluminized, single-pipe exhaust system runs the entire length of the floor. And everything rolls on heavy-duty steelies, which twist 30x9.50R15 BF Goodrich Mud Terrain T/As around predictable Ford lockers.
